When coming from 2nd you would always wave someone unless you know 100% they are going to stop at 3b. You wave them so they make the turn. Then the 3b coach needs to set up down far enough down the line so that the runner can see them once they make the turn and know to stop or go.

 

We were literally just working on this on my son’s little league team a month or so ago. Both first base and third. The three plays and signs by the coach are run straight through the base then turn in so you are out of play. Make a turn towards 2b and depending on situation go to 2b or come back to the bag at 1b. The coach is supposed to be giving signs and verbal commands.

 

We tell the kids every drill. Pick up your base coaches, stop looking at the ball, especially on infield hits. Pick up your base coaches!!!!

 

I can’t tell from the video where Rivera put up the stop sign. However, it would be normal to windmill so he makes the turn at 3b and then heads down the line a little vs sliding into 3b just stopping on the bag. Once Bo makes the turn he needs to pick up the coach also, who should be down the line in front of him.
